Strike continues as ASUU and FG meeting ends in deadlock

The industrial strike continues as the meeting between the Academic staff union of Nigerian university, ASUU and federal government ended in a gridlock yesterday.

According to ASUU President, Prof. Osodeke Emmanuel, “Professor Nimi Briggs headed the meeting with the FG’s team. There was no new offer on the table; they simply begged us to call off the strike”., ASUU

According to a top ministry official, The lecturers left the venue angrily. He said, “though we cannot ascertain what was discussed with them as you can see, we were not invited, but the proposal presented was rejected,”

A member of the ASUU National Executive Committee who asked not to be quoted stated the government was “unserious” with the negotiations.

The union President further stated, “We didn’t sign anything; they did not come with anything good. I can’t go into details. We will talk to our members first before we talk to the press. We represent our members.’’
